A dancing called modern-day or moderna was established most likely from around 2005 on the "western standard" standard aspects. The basics coincide as the "western traditional" dancing, however with included dancing elements as well as styling from Salsa, tango as well as Ballroom. In this dancing, pairs typically move their torsos a lot more and significantly exaggerate the hip pop.

Who would certainly have ever before envisioned that bachata would certainly penetrate the American markets the way it has? Over the recent years urban bachata artists have actually collaborated with hip-hop and R&B entertainers and also had their videos offered on MTV. Several would certainly transform hit English tracks right into the genre, a technique that proved effective when Royal prince Royce's city bachata handle the Ben E. King traditional "Stand By Me" ended up being a significant hit in the Latin market. The Bachata dance is danced to the beats of the Bachata music.
